About me
I am an incoming CS PhD student at the University of Pittsburgh, with research interests in multimodal learning for NLP. I focus on developing robust language systems that combine speech, text, and video to improve natural language understanding in real-world settings.
Most recently, I was at SpeechAce, where I led the development of the companyโs AI-powered Writing Assessment Platform. My work spanned ML engineering and data engineering, including designing NLP pipelines for text analysis and building models that perform reliably in resource-constrained, production environments. The platform is deployed across 20+ countries, serving clients like Pearson.
My broader research interest lies in long-context multimodal LLM reasoning, developing methods that allow large language models to effectively integrate and reason across speech, text, and video over extended contexts, with an emphasis on robustness, interpretability, and efficiency.
Before SpeechAce, I was a Research Assistant at Northwestern University, where I developed a multimodal model for speech disfluency detection at the Ideas Lab, focusing on robustness to missing modalities. I also contributed to video super-resolution research at the Image and Video Processing Lab (IVPL). I hold a Masterโs degree in Computer Engineering from Northwestern.
